Abstract: For dinN and Omegaeemptyset an open set in Rd, we consider the eigenfunctions Phi of the Dirichlet Laplacian DeltaOmega of Omega. If Phi is associated with an eigenvalue below the essential spectrum of DeltaOmega we provide estimates for the L1-norm of Phi in terms of its L2-norm and spectral data. These L1-estimates are then used in the comparison of the heat content of Omega at time t>0 and the heat trace at times t>0, where a two-sided estimate is established. We furthermore show that all eigenfunctions of DeltaOmega which are associated with a discrete eigenvalue of HOmega, belong to L1(Omega).
